Daily flossing is essential to healthy teeth. Take a generous amount of dental floss and insert it gently between your teeth. Move the floss up from the gum on the side of each tooth. This will remove plaque that you can't reach with your toothbrush and help keep your teeth their cleanest.

Always use toothpaste that contains fluoride. There are very few toothpastes available that do not contain fluoride, but some of the newer organic toothpastes do not. Fluoride is essential for strong and healthy teeth. So if you want to use an organic toothpaste that does not contain fluoride, use it after you brush with a fluoride toothpaste.

While flossing is very important, make sure you do it gently. If you floss too hard, you can cause gum pain, irritation, swelling, and bleeding to occur. To get rid of plaque without harming your mouth, gently slide the floss back and forth in between your teeth. Follow the curves of each tooth in an up and down motion.

If you notice an increase in cavities, consider taking a multivitamin. Multivitamins contain many vitamins and minerals necessary for enamel production. Enamel is the outer layer that hardens your teeth and protects them. Your diet should include a variety of sources of calcium, which is the building block of healthy teeth.

If you have old, mercury fillings, consider having them replaced. Mercury causes harm to people; a large amount in your mouth may result in health issues. Thankfully, dentists now use safer materials for their fillings. Speak with your dentist the next time you have an appointment.

If you have a tooth that is causing you pain, you should contact your dentist immediately. Pain that's severe and has been going on for a while may mean that you have an infection that you need to take care of right away. Call the dentist to alert him to the problem, and then see him as soon as you can. Teeth infections can get into your blood and go to the brain if you don't deal with them right away.

If you have diabetes, it is essential that you practice good dental hygiene. Diabetics have a higher risk of periodontal disease. Other dental issues are also more common in diabetics. Good dental hygiene can help you common dental problems like cavities, gum disease, and thrush. Regular check-ups are also recommended.

While baking soda is found in many toothpastes, it should never solely be used when brushing your teeth. Baking soda by itself will erode enamel. And it can cause cavities.

To prevent your teeth from getting stained by coffee or tea, have a little sip of water after you enjoy your beverage. The water can rinse away some of the staining and slow down the build up of the stains. If you cannot brush after you drink a dark beverage, sip some water.

You can lessen the staining effects of certain beverages by drinking through a straw. Colas stain the teeth. So do teas, coffees and wines. You can avoid some of the staining effects by drinking through a straw, which helps the liquids bypass the teeth. You should still brush immediately after drinking these beverages, however.
